wife has a 89 Mazda MX6, no clear coat from the factory that i know of, and lots of oxidation (at least that is what i think the white spots are)

will XMT #2 get it out? or 3M's Fine Cut Rubbing compound with a Orange LC pad on my 7424? i have access to all of the above

thanks
 
I never used rubbing compound by 3M, I think it is designed for rotary use.
Remember, you want to start with the least agressive product, then if it won't do the job, move up to a little more agressive. So, start with XMT 2 on orange pad, do a little section at a time (18'x18'), then check your results. If it won't work, I would move up to XMT3 or SSR 2.5.
